@LZeeW I tried everything that I can think of. I even tried to connect my old router (Apple Extreme) and my original Aria was able to connect on the first setup (i haven't used it since 2017 because I've been using a different router, LinkSys WRT-3200ACM, where it doesn't have the B standard which Aria requires). Aria 2 works on the N standard which my LinkSys router has (on the 2.4GHz band). Still it failed. Says it was able to connect successfully but won't sync afterwards (just like the others are experiencing). That Aria 2 was an utter failure. I'm back to using the Aria 1 and regretted buying the Aria 2. It's back on the box and will be for sale. Maybe it will work somewhere else (or maybe not). Waste of time and money.

it uses an older type of wifi. if your router is set to use n or new only then it won't work. I think b is the correct one for it
04-13-2019 06:53
04-13-2019 06:53
@Tytan You are correct my friend! The Aria scale connects with routers that run the protocol 802.11b or mixed mode (b,g,n) only.
